dispose is called from createTextArea when CCE is thrown so ideally the
EDT should be inside dispose() function. I guess it will be clean if you
remove dispose() from CCE and add frame.dispose() under try-finally
clause in main() itself. I guess frame.setIconImage() also is not needed.
Also, please add @Override annotation to run() method of EDT.

>> Issue : This issue is a regression of
>> https://bugs.openjdk.java.net/browse/JDK-8030702.
>> When UndoableEditEvent.getEdit() is casted to
>> CompoundEdit, it throws class cast exception.
>> Fix : In JDK-8030702
>> <https://bugs.openjdk.java.net/browse/JDK-8030702> a new
>> class DefaultDocumentEventUndoableWrapper was introduced.
>> UndoableEditEvent.getEdit() returns an object of
>> DefaultDocumentEventUndoableWrapper and when it is casted
>> to CompoundEdit it throws class cast exception because
>> it doesn’t inherit CompoundEdit.
>> Before the fix of JDK-8030702
>> <https://bugs.openjdk.java.net/browse/JDK-8030702> ,
>> UndoableEditEvent.getEdit() used to return an object of
>> DefaultDocumentEvent which inherits CompoundEdit so the
>> class cast exception was not thrown.
>> The solution is to make
>> DefaultDocumentEventUndoableWrapper a subclass of
>> DefaultDocumentEvent.
>> Testing : I have tested it on Mac, Windows and Ubuntu.
